When a number is multiplied by itself thrice, the resultant number is called the cube of a number. Cubing is used when comparing sizes of objects or things with cubic measurements. In this topic, we shall learn about cubes of 625.

Cube of 625

A cube number is a value obtained by raising a number to the power of 3 or by multiplying the number by itself three times. When you cube a positive number, the result is always positive. When you cube a negative number, the result is always negative. This is because a negative number by itself three times results in a negative number.

The cube of 625 can be written as 625³, which is the exponential form. Or it can also be written in arithmetic form as 625 × 625 × 625.

Using a Formula (a³)

The formula (a + b)³ is a binomial formula for finding the cube of a number. The formula is expanded as a³ + 3a²b + 3ab² + b³.

Step 1: Split the number 625 into two parts, as 600 and 25. Let a = 600 and b = 25, so a + b = 625

Step 2: Now, apply the formula (a + b)³ = a³ + 3a²b + 3ab² + b³

Step 3: Calculate each term

a³ = 600³

3a²b = 3 × 600² × 25

3ab² = 3 × 600 × 25²

b³ = 25³

Step 4: Add all the terms together:

(a + b)³ = a³ + 3a²b + 3ab² + b³

(600 + 25)³ = 600³ + 3 × 600² × 25 + 3 × 600 × 25² + 25³

625³ = 216,000,000 + 27,000,000 + 11,250,000 + 15,625

625³ = 244,140,625

Step 5: Hence, the cube of 625 is 244,140,625.

Problem 1

What is the cube and cube root of 625?

Okay, lets begin

The cube of 625 is 244,140,625 and the cube root of 625 is approximately 8.5499.

Explanation

First, let’s find the cube of 625.

We know that the cube of a number, such that x³ = y Where x is the given number, and y is the cubed value of that number

So, we get 625³ = 244,140,625

Next, we must find the cube root of 625 We know that the cube root of a number ‘x’, such that ³√x = y Where ‘x’ is the given number, and y is the cube root value of the number

So, we get ³√625 = 8.5499

Hence the cube of 625 is 244,140,625, and the cube root of 625 is approximately 8.5499.

Problem 2

If the side length of the cube is 625 cm, what is the volume?

Okay, lets begin

The volume is 244,140,625 cm³.

Explanation

Use the volume formula for a cube V = Side³.

Substitute 625 for the side length: V = 625³ = 244,140,625 cm³.

Problem 3

How much larger is 625³ than 600³?

Okay, lets begin

625³ – 600³ = 28,140,625.

Explanation

First find the cube of 625³, that is 244,140,625

Next, find the cube of 600³, which is 216,000,000

Now, find the difference between them using the subtraction method.

244,140,625 – 216,000,000 = 28,140,625

Therefore, the 625³ is 28,140,625 larger than 600³.

FAQs on Cube of 625

1.What are the perfect cubes up to 625?

The perfect cubes up to 625 are 1, 8, 27, 64, 125, 216, 343, and 512.

2.How do you calculate 625³?

To calculate 625³, use the multiplication method, 625 × 625 × 625, which equals 244,140,625.

3.What is the meaning of 625³?

625³ means 625 multiplied by itself three times, or 625 × 625 × 625.

4.What is the cube root of 625?

The cube root of 625 is approximately 8.5499.

5.Is 625 a perfect cube?

No, 625 is not a perfect cube because no integer multiplied by itself three times equals 625.

Important Glossaries for Cube of 625

  • Binomial Formula: An algebraic expression used to expand the powers of a number, written as (a + b)ⁿ, where ‘n’ is a positive integer raised to the base. The formula is used to find the square and cube of a number.
  • Cube of a Number: Multiplying a number by itself three times is called the cube of a number.
  • Exponential Form: A way of expressing numbers using a base and an exponent (or power), where the exponent value indicates how many times the base is multiplied by itself. For example, 2³ represents 2 × 2 × 2 equals 8.
  • Cube Root: The value that, when multiplied by itself three times, gives the original number.
  • Perfect Cube: A number that is the cube of an integer. For example, 27 is a perfect cube because it is 3³.
